Freehold six-bedroom Georgian‑Revival detached house, circa 5,034 sq ft
A substantial, newly renovated Georgian‑Revival detached house in Hampstead Garden Suburb, offering over 5,000 sq ft of flexible family living. The house combines period proportions with high-spec modern finishes: a large open-plan kitchen with premium Miele and Gaggenau appliances, multiple reception rooms, six bedrooms and six bathrooms, plus a lower-ground entertainment level with a golf simulator. Practical features include underfloor heating, air conditioning, mechanical ventilation and comprehensive security installation.
The layout suits an extended or multi-generational family, with a principal suite and dressing room, several ensuite bedrooms, a self-contained lower-ground bedroom and kitchen, and generous storage throughout. Outside, a large landscaped garden is fitted for outdoor cooking and entertaining, with patio wiring, hot water and integrated speakers. A carriage driveway provides off-street parking.
Buyers should note a few material points: the property is constructed in solid brick with assumed no cavity insulation in the walls, glazing is secondary rather than full double glazing, and broadband speeds in the immediate area are reported as slow. Council tax is described as very expensive. These are factual considerations for running costs and potential retrofit works despite the house’s recent full renovation.
Positioned close to top-rated primary and secondary schools, local sports and leisure facilities, and with low local crime, the house is aimed at buyers seeking a large, high-spec family home in one of North London’s most desirable neighbourhoods.
